In summer 286 ships sailed into NSW bringing over 600,000 passengers to the state. 9News

bringing over 600,000 passengers to the state, and the season's numbers were just below pre-pandemic levels.

Cruise passengers like Marilyn, who is is celebrating her 70th birthday onboard a cruise, are excited the industry is growing again.Cruise ships docking in NSW this winter are expected to double last season's passenger numbers.NSW Port Authority CEO Philip Holliday said it was a sign the health of the industry was growing.

"We've got new cruise lines coming, we've got a complete diversity of the sorts of ships that have something for everybody," he said.Carnival Cruise Line president Maguerite Fitzgerald said there was still space available on most cruises this winter.
